Prime Minister Narendra Modi graced the Bharat Mandapam in the national capital on Friday to bestow the National Creators Award, an initiative aimed at celebrating creativity and its transformative power in driving positive change.
Understanding the National Creators Award
In acknowledgment of the burgeoning creator economy, particularly propelled by social media platforms such as Instagram, Facebook, X, and others, Prime Minister Narendra Modi introduced a new category of awards—The Creators.

The National Creators Award seeks to honor excellence and impact across various domains, ranging from storytelling and social change advocacy to environmental sustainability, education, and gaming. Positioned as a catalyst for leveraging creativity to foster constructive societal transformation, these awards hold significant promise for acknowledging the innovative endeavors of digital creators.
Selection Process and Criteria
The nomination window for the National Creators Award was open on the Innovate India website from February 10th to February 29th, 2024.
Impressively, over 1.5 lakh nominations were received, accompanied by approximately 10 lakh votes cast by the public. The awards are primarily based on the number of votes garnered by each creator, reflecting a democratic and inclusive approach to recognizing talent and impact.
Diverse Categories Reflecting Creativity
The National Creators Award encompasses twenty distinctive categories, catering to a broad spectrum of creative pursuits and contributions. These include recognitions such as the Best Storyteller Award, Disruptor of the Year, Celebrity Creator of the Year, Green Champion Award, and Best Creator for Social Change, among others. With a focus on acknowledging creators across diverse fields, these categories celebrate innovation, social impact, and cultural relevance.

Celebrating Excellence: Winners of National Creator Award 2024
The culmination of the National Creators Award ceremony witnessed the accolades being conferred upon deserving recipients across various categories. Notable awardees include Shraddha Jain (AiyyoShraddha) and RJ Raunac (Bauaa) receiving the Most Creative Creator Awards in the female and male categories, respectively. Additionally, individuals such as Jahnvi Singh, Kabita Singh, and Pankhti Pandey were honored for their contributions to heritage fashion, culinary arts, and environmental advocacy, respectively.

Other esteemed awardees include Keerthika Govindasamy for Best Storyteller, Maithili Thakur as the Cultural Ambassador of the Year, and Ranveer Allahbadia (BeerBiceps) as the Disruptor of the Year. These individuals exemplify excellence and innovation in their respective fields, embodying the spirit of creativity and positive impact.
